Ubuntu安装Anaconda3+Tensorflow

1 安装Anaconda3

1.1下载安装脚本

wget https://repo.continuum.io/archive/Anaconda3-5.1.0-Linux-x86_64.sh

1.2 运行安装脚本

bash Anaconda3-5.1.0-Linux-x86_64.sh

1.3 加入环境变量

sudo vim ~/.bashrc
export PATH="/home/felicia/Downloads/bio_software/anaconda3/bin:$PATH"
source ~/.bashrc

1.4 更换清华源

con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--set show_channel_urls yes

2 安装Tensorflow

2.1 创建conda计算环境

conda create -n tensorflow

#激活环境
source activate tensorflow
去激活
source deactivate

2.2 激活环境

source activate tensorflow

2.3 安装tensorflow

conda install -n tensorflow -c https://anaconda.org/conda-forge tensorflow

2.4 查看是否安装成功

conda list

python3
import tensorflow as tf
hello = tf.constant("Hello, Tensorflow!")
sess = tf.Session()
print(sess.run(hello))
输出
Hello, Tensorflow!

解决Spyder无法导入Tensorflow模块问题

cp -ri /home/felicia/Downloads/bio_software/anaconda3/envs/tensorflow/lib/python3.6/site-packages/* /home/felicia/Downloads/bio_software/anaconda3/lib/python3.6/site-packages/

results matching ""

    No results matching ""